Output 4ebd6aee40d69f1c40fc0fcb341e86baa10dfdf4cbf0cfd2039edea36bf9bbdf:1

value
1987000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ba45da7713fdb2bd46a53cc911fd194075217ca2 OP_EQUAL
address
3JfwHiqREqLWvSpgsNG6fqUeQvzTZbYdvQ
transaction
4ebd6aee40d69f1c40fc0fcb341e86baa10dfdf4cbf0cfd2039edea36bf9bbdf
confirmations
427343
spent
true